Paralympian cyclist Sarah Storey was partnered with Sudocrem by MN2S for a new campaign focused on cycling.

MN2S has teamed up Dame Sarah Storey with Sudocrem for a new campaign focused on encouraging families across the UK to get on their bikes and raise money for Ickle Pickles, a charitable organisation that supports mothers with premature babies. Cycle More aims to reassure British families that cycling is healthy, good for the environment and inspires confidence and independence in young people. As a Paralympian cyclist with several gold medals under her belt, Sarah Storey was the perfect choice to deliver this message.

“Cycling is a great way to build resilience and promote independence.”

Dame Sarah Storey

Speaking about the importance of the campaign, Dame Sarah said: “I am delighted to be involved with Sudocrem’s Cycle More campaign. Cycling with my family brings me so much joy and I’d really love for more families to benefit from the thrill of being out on bikes together. Cycling is such an amazing feeling and it’s a really fun way of getting around. Apart from the obvious health benefits of getting out in the fresh air and being physically active, cycling is a great way to build resilience and promote independence. My children both love that they can choose a route and ‘lead the way!'”
